(Amendment)Protective clothing against liquid chemicals - performance requirements for clothing with liquid-tight (Type 3) or spray-tight (Type 4) connections, including items providing protection to parts of the body only (Types PB [3] and PB [4])
Protective clothing against liquid chemicals - performance requirements for clothing with liquid-tight (Type 3) or spray-tight (Type 4) connections, including items providing protection to parts of the body only (Types PB [3] and PB [4])
- delete the last row of table 1 (reference to EN 14325, clause 4.14)
- add, at the end of clause 4.1, the following note: "If resistance to heat and flame is required, the chemical protective clothing should be tested and marked according to the appropriate standard." (taken from EN 14325, 4.14)
add in clause 6 (information) the warning phrase: "Flammable material. Keep away from fire"

Overview
EN 14605:2005/prA1 is a European standard developed by CEN that specifies performance requirements for protective clothing against liquid chemicals. This standard covers garments designed with liquid-tight (Type 3) or spray-tight (Type 4) connections, including specialized items that provide protection to only parts of the body (Types PB [3] and PB [4]). The standard ensures that protective wear meets stringent criteria to safeguard workers from chemical hazards during handling, spraying, or accidental exposure.
This latest amendment refines testing protocols and enhances safety information disclosures, emphasizing practical use and hazard prevention in chemical protective clothing.
Key Topics
Protective Clothing Types:
- Type 3: Clothing with liquid-tight connections providing full body protection against liquid chemicals.
- Type 4: Clothing with spray-tight connections designed to protect the wearer from sprayed chemical substances.
- Partial Body Protection (PB[3] and PB[4]): Garments that cover and protect only specific body parts from liquid chemical exposure.
Performance Testing Updates:
The amendment modifies clause 4.1 by deleting the last row of Table 1, which referred to EN 14325, clause 4.14. A new note highlights that if resistance to heat and flame is required, the clothing should be tested and marked per the relevant heat/flame standards.Manufacturer Information Requirements:
Clause 6 has been updated to mandate the inclusion of a warning phrase:
"Flammable material. Keep away from fire."
This addition is key for user safety, alerting wearers and handlers about flammability risks associated with the materials.Compliance and Standard Integration:
The amendment supports conformity with EC Directives via harmonized testing methods and documentation to assure safety and regulatory compliance throughout Europe.

This draft amendment is submitted to CEN members for unique acceptance procedure. It has been drawn up by the Technical Committee
CEN/TC 162.
This draft amendment A1, if approved, will modify the European Standard EN 14605:2005. If this draft becomes an amendment, CEN
members are bound to comply with the CEN/CENELEC Internal Regulations which stipulate the conditions for inclusion of this amendment
into the relevant national standard without any alteration.
